Greek-Style Baked Cod with Tomatoes & Olives

Flaky baked cod with juicy cherry tomatoes, olives, garlic and herbs…simple, healthy, and packed with flavour.
Servings 2
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es

Ingredients
  

  • 2 skinless cod fillets approx. 150–180g each
  • 200 g cherry tomatoes halved
  • 1 small red onion thinly sliced
  • 2 garlic cloves thinly sliced
  • 50 g black olives pitted, whole or halved
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• ½ tsp dried oregano
  • Zest of ½ lemon
  • Juice of ½ lemon
  • Salt and black pepper
  • Fresh parsley or basil to garnish (optional)
  • Lemon wedges to serve

Instructions
 

  • Preheat your oven to 200°C (180°C fan).
  • In an oven-safe baking dish like this, combine the cherry tomatoes, red onion, garlic, olives, olive oil, oregano, lemon zest and a good pinch of salt and pepper. Toss gently to coat.
  • Place the cod fillets on top, nestling them into the veg. Juice half a lemon using a citrus juicer like this and drizzle it over the fish and and then season with a little extra salt and pepper.
  • Bake for 18–20 minutes, or until the cod is opaque and flakes easily with a fork.
  • Serve straight from the dish using a fish spatula like this to lift the cod fillets gently without breaking them apart and sprinkle with fresh herbs on top and lemon wedges on the side.

Top Tips for this Greek-Style Baked Cod with Tomatoes & Olives

Use ripe cherry tomatoes: They’ll release more juice and sweetness into the dish as they roast.
Check the cod early: Fish can overcook quickly; it’s done when it flakes easily with a fork.
Add a splash of white wine: A little poured into the baking dish lifts the flavours and makes extra sauce.
Want more punch? Crumble in a bit of feta before baking or scatter some capers in with the olives.
